Being the second of two persons or things mentioned; near or nearer to the end. It has more to do with placement, so to speak. Location, real or figurative. Between captain and major, the latter is the higher rank. My favorite is the latter part of the book. Later has more to do with time. farmer and company real estate metropolisWebApr 27, 2024 · I prefer his latter book over his first. If this means a preference for the second book, it only works if there are only two books.
